Opinion: Prof joins dissent of Mo. tactics toward med training

UW Nursing dean emerita co-authors letter condemning legislation to intervene in abortion-related education, research

A letter from eight academic faculty across the nation criticized the Missouri General Assembly for its efforts to create laws that would halt clinical training and research related to abortion and women's reproductive health.

The letter was signed by Nancy Woods, professor and dean emerita in the University of Washington School of Nursing.
